y varies inversely with x, and x = 120 when y = 90. Find the inverse variation equation and use it to find the value of x when y = 30. 210 40 360 22.5

OpenStudy (anonymous):

\[\huge y=\frac{k}{x}\rightarrow 90=\frac{k}{120} \] solve for k then find x with the new y value....
